How much do data engineering j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for data engineering in Silver Spring, MD is $170,592.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$138,000.00 and $175,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a data engineer do?

Data Engineers regularly design,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ines to support analytics and business intelligence teams. Their daily tasks often involve working with large datasets, optimizing data storage, ensuring data integrity, and troubleshooting data-related issues. Collaboration with data scientists, analysts, and software engineers is common to align on data requirements and improve workflows. You may also participate in regular code reviews and contribute to the ongoing improvement of data infrastructure. This role is ideal for problem-solvers who enjoy working with both code and complex systems in a collaborative, fast-paced environment.

What is data engineering?

A Data Engineering job involves designing, building, and maintaining the infrastructure that enables efficient data collection, storage, and processing. Data Engineers develop pipelines to transform raw data into usable formats for analytics and machine learning. They work with databases, big data technologies, and cloud platforms to ensure data is accessible and reliable. Their role is crucial for organizations to make data-driven decisions and optimize business processes.

Are data engineers still in demand?

Data engineers are currently in high demand due to the increasing reliance on data-driven decision making and the growth of big data technologies. They are essential for building and maintaining data pipelines, often working with tools like Apache Spark, Hadoop, and cloud platforms, and typically require strong programming and database skills. The demand is expected to remain strong as organizations continue to prioritize data infrastructure.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a data engineer?

To thrive in Data Engineering, you need a solid background in programming (such as Python, Java, or Scala), data modeling, and database management,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with ETL tools, cloud platforms like AWS or Azure, big data frameworks (e.g., Hadoop, Spark), and relevant certifications is high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and the ability to work collaboratively across teams are key soft skills for this role. These attributes are crucial for designing robust data pipelines, ensuring data quality, and enabling organizations to make data-driven decisions efficiently.

Title and Summary

Manager, Data EngineeringOverview:
Mastercard Services Technology is seeking a Manager, Data Engineering to lead the delivery of data solutions that power client engagements across Test & Learn and other Services products. In this role, you will manage a team of Data Engineers responsible for designing, building, and maintaining scalable data pipelines and enterprise data solutions that enable impactful business insights for clients worldwide.
The Test & Learn team aims to build industry-leading business experimentation software that brings sophisticated analytic techniques to business users around the world. We are rapidly expanding our product offerings and innovating on how we deliver Test & Learn solutions to our clients.
This is a hybrid role based in Arlington, VA, with an expectation of three days per week onsite.
Role:
Lead, mentor, and develop a team of 4-10 Data Engineers, fostering accountability, collaboration, innovation, and continuous learning.
Drive end-to-end delivery of high-quality, scalable data solutions across multiple clients, industries, and concurrent projects.
Own the design, development, automation, and maintenance of large-scale enterprise ETL and data integration pipelines supporting a global client base.
Lead Agile team operations including goal setting, sprint planning, capacity management, work allocation, and retrospectives.
Provide ongoing coaching, performance management, and career development support to team members.
Serve as a technical leader and subject matter expert in data architecture, engineering standards, and solution design.
Partner with analytics teams, product managers, and business stakeholders to translate requirements into scalable data solutions.
Leverage SQL and modern database technologies to optimize performance, streamline processing, and manage large-scale datasets efficiently.
Define and enforce engineering best practices including version control, code reviews, testing frameworks, monitoring, and data quality controls.
Identify and drive automation and process improvement initiatives that enhance efficiency, scalability, and reliability of data delivery.
Build and maintain str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ders across global teams and client organizations.
Ensure compliance with Mastercard policies, security standards, and applicable regulatory and regulatory requirements.
All About You:
Proven experience in Data Engineering or a related field, with strong expertise in data architecture, data modeling, database design, and scalable data solutions.
Prior people management experience is preferred. Candidates with strong leadership experience in a team lead or senior individual contributor capacity may also be considered.
Strong track record of delivering complex initiatives while balancing competing priorities and stakeholder needs.
Advanced SQL skills, including performance tuning, query optimization, and large-scale data processing.
Deep hands-on experience with Microsoft SQL Server and relational database technologies.
Experience designing, implementing, and maintaining ETL pipelines and data integration frameworks.
Experience with Databricks, Spark, or modern cloud-based data platforms is a plus.
Interest in emerging engineering productivity tools and AI-assisted development technologies (e.g., GitHub Copilot), with a willingness to explore and adopt new capabilities.
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to think strategically and drive innovation.
Experience managing projects, people, and delivery processes while ensuring quality, accuracy, and operational excellence.
Exceptional communication and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to convey complex technical concepts to both technical and non-technical audiences.
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Computer Science, Mathematics, Finance, Business, or a related quantitative discipline; equivalent practical experience will also be considered.
